Spurs must convert Paris performance into derby win against Fulham

Imagem do artigo:Spurs must convert Paris performance into derby win against Fulham

Tottenham Hotspur approach the weekend seeking a positive result to match the progress they showed in Paris after consecutive defeats had raised questions about their early-season direction.

Their 5-3 loss to Paris Saint-Germain exposed familiar defensive lapses but it also offered evidence of a sharper, more assertive performance than the disjointed display that cost them heavily against Arsenal.

Thomas Frank’s side led twice against the Champions League holders and showed greater structure in possession, which has encouraged belief that their recent run does not tell the full story of their current level.

Spurs still face the reality of four defeats in six matches and pressure to convert improved passages of play into points, particularly with their position in the Premier League table remaining fragile.

Saturday’s meeting with Fulham therefore arrives at an important moment for a team looking to validate the signs of recovery they displayed in midweek.

Fulham travel across London with issues of their own and remain one of the league’s most inconsistent sides, which makes them difficult to predict and dangerous when allowed time to settle.

Marco Silva’s team have mixed promising spells with long passive stretches, and their results have swung sharply between convincing displays and flat, error-ridden showings.

Their inconsistency leaves Spurs unsure which version they will face, and the hosts know they must be prepared for a Fulham side capable of imposing themselves when rhythm is found early.

Fulham’s away form has been poor this season but they enter the derby fresh from a narrow win over Sunderland that eased some pressure and reinforced their ability to grind out results.

Goals have remained scarce for Silva’s side and several matches have been tight, low-scoring contests decided by individual moments rather than sustained control.

Spurs, meanwhile, have struggled at home and are searching for only their second league victory at the Tottenham Hotspur Stadium this season, which adds further weight to the fixture.

Frank is expected to restore several first-choice players after rotating heavily in Paris, and the side’s response in midweek suggests the group retains belief despite recent setbacks.

Tottenham will need that renewed energy on Saturday because they cannot rely on Fulham’s inconsistency to hand them opportunities.

A composed, disciplined performance would give Spurs the chance to lift the mood for good and convert midweek optimism into a result that steadies their Premier League campaign.
